Skip to main content

Generic development cli for various application types.

Project description

What is Devious?

Devious is a command line utility to manage the lifecycle of applications in a mono repository. It is developed in the context of a VSCode-based development container template (see devious).

What can I do with Devious?

  • create, build, test, debug applications locally
  • deploy, run and stop applications (e.g. on remote machines)
  • Manage remote machines and install infrastructure

What kind of applications does Devious support?

Devious features an extensible target model and can provide functionality for any application type that implements the Target interface. It currently supports microservice and django_app targets and can manage their lifecycle.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

devious-0.16.0.tar.gz (23.0 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

devious-0.16.0-py3-none-any.whl (40.5 kB view details)

Uploaded Python 3

File details

Details for the file devious-0.16.0.tar.gz.

File metadata

  • Download URL: devious-0.16.0.tar.gz
  • Upload date:
  • Size: 23.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.2 CPython/3.10.12 Linux/6.8.0-58-generic

File hashes

Hashes for devious-0.16.0.tar.gz
Algorithm Hash digest
SHA256 a5df69610b29b36e14b5df37abbc1a09458a59445dcb3eb9a4885e0e876e4631
MD5 cdffcf5bd11f8ff5cb9ac8a96e684590
BLAKE2b-256 4f5f4a88f2fd6aee10b1e75920278e5f71d0a20f0724bf59fbed07ea102bb23c

See more details on using hashes here.

File details

Details for the file devious-0.16.0-py3-none-any.whl.

File metadata

  • Download URL: devious-0.16.0-py3-none-any.whl
  • Upload date:
  • Size: 40.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/2.1.2 CPython/3.10.12 Linux/6.8.0-58-generic

File hashes

Hashes for devious-0.16.0-py3-none-any.whl
Algorithm Hash digest
SHA256 6d97f63755c7ba380c6ca89e6127cc9a99267a7d885ef1a5779a62d95a9aab2a
MD5 89db20ff58bdabe2d69aa15cbb898849
BLAKE2b-256 d0e527c80e61d2d741ede913de182b70b5c583bf0ea5184f41184e4a27957890

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page